Where must registration numbers be display?

On both sides at the bow. There is a lettering height and size requirement, information which would be available from the US Coast Guard.

Where must a vessels registration number and?

A vessel's registration number must be displayed on both sides of the bow (front) of the vessel, clearly visible and in contrasting colors to the background. Additionally, it should be placed as high as practical to ensure visibility. If applicable, the vessel's name should also be displayed in a similar manner, typically on the stern (back) of the vessel.
